Understanding Adidas Senior Discount Programs and Partnerships
Adidas offers various pathways through which seniors can access discounted pricing on athletic footwear, apparel, and equipment. Rather than a single unified senior program, Adidas coordinates discounts through multiple channels and partnerships that mature adults can explore. According to recent retail data, approximately 43% of Americans aged 65 and older actively engage in some form of physical activity, making access to quality athletic gear increasingly important for this demographic.
The primary way seniors discover Adidas discounts involves understanding the company's broader discount structure. Adidas periodically partners with organizations that serve older adults, including AARP and other senior-focused networks. These partnerships create opportunities for members to access promotional codes and special pricing events. Additionally, Adidas maintains a clearance section on its website where past-season items sell at significantly reduced prices—often 30-50% below retail value. This resource remains available year-round and doesn't require membership or age verification.
Major retailers that carry Adidas products also offer senior discount days. Dick's Sporting Goods, for example, runs periodic promotions targeting older shoppers. Foot Locker occasionally coordinates senior-focused events during national retail promotions. Understanding these various channels allows seniors to strategically time purchases for maximum savings. Many people find that combining a base discount with end-of-season sales can reduce footwear costs by 50-70%.

How to Access Adidas Discounts Through Major Retailer Programs
Several major sporting goods retailers have developed senior discount programs that apply to Adidas merchandise. Dick's Sporting Goods offers senior discount days on specific dates throughout the year, typically providing 10% off purchases for customers aged 60 and older. This discount applies to nearly all merchandise, including Adidas products. Participating customers simply present identification at checkout to receive the discount. Actual dates vary by location, so contacting your local store or checking their website helps identify upcoming senior discount events in your area.
Academy Sports and Outdoors implements a comparable approach, offering senior discounts during designated promotional periods. Foot Locker has historically run senior discount events during back-to-school seasons and major holidays. Best Buy's senior discount program, while primarily focused on electronics, occasionally extends to Adidas products available through their sporting goods sections. Kohl's, which carries Adidas apparel and some footwear, regularly offers senior discounts combined with their standard promotional codes, sometimes resulting in cumulative savings of 20-30%.
Understanding the mechanics of these programs maximizes savings potential. Many retailers allow seniors to combine a base senior discount with ongoing sales. For example, if an Adidas shoe costs $120, a standard 10% senior discount reduces the price to $108. If that same shoe is already on clearance for 30% off ($84), some retailers apply the senior discount to the already-reduced price, bringing it to approximately $75.60. Always ask cashiers whether senior discounts apply to sale merchandise, as policies vary by location and retailer.
Beyond in-store options, many large retailers offer online shopping with senior discounts. The process typically involves creating an account and indicating your age, after which discount codes appear on your account dashboard or through email. Shipping policies vary—some retailers offer free shipping on senior orders above certain thresholds, while others charge standard rates. Planning purchases to meet free shipping minimums can provide additional savings beyond the initial discount.

Leveraging Online Shopping and Digital Discount Codes
The digital landscape offers substantial opportunities for seniors to access Adidas discounts without visiting physical stores. The official Adidas website features a dedicated clearance section updated regularly with deeply discounted inventory. During peak clearance periods—particularly after seasonal changes and major holidays—this section contains shoes marked down 40-60% from original prices. Many items in the clearance section have never been price-protected online, meaning they represent genuine markdown opportunities rather than temporary sales.
Discount code aggregator websites like RetailMeNot, Honey, and Brad's Deals compile current promotional codes for Adidas and authorized retailers. These platforms allow users to filter codes by discount percentage, product category, or required minimum purchase amounts. According to user data, approximately 35-40% of available codes can save customers between 15-25% on purchases. While not all codes work simultaneously, many users report success finding at least one usable code during any given shopping session.
Email newsletter subscription represents one of the most reliable ways to access exclusive digital codes. When seniors subscribe to the Adidas newsletter, they typically receive a first-time shopper code (usually 10-15% off) and regular promotional updates. Many newsletter subscribers report receiving birthday month coupons providing additional discounts during their birth month. Creating separate email addresses specifically for retail newsletters helps manage promotional volume while ensuring discount notifications don't get lost in general inbox clutter.
Social media platforms, particularly Facebook and Instagram, often feature exclusive promotional codes shared only to followers. Adidas frequently posts limited-time codes on these platforms that appear nowhere else. Following the official Adidas account and enabling notifications ensures you see these opportunities. Additionally, many independent sports retailers specializing in Adidas products promote exclusive codes through their social channels—these smaller retailers sometimes offer deeper discounts than major chains to attract customers.
Seasonal shopping strategies maximize digital discount potential. Back-to-school season (July-August) and holiday periods (November-December) feature the most aggressive promotions. However, counter-intuitive timing—shopping in February or September when retailers have less promotional pressure—sometimes reveals clearance codes that offer better value than advertised sales. Many people find that combining a seasonal code with clearance section shopping produces the best overall savings.

Understanding Senior Membership Programs and Loyalty Benefits
While Adidas doesn't operate a seniors-only membership program, the company's Creators Club loyalty program can help many older adults accumulate rewards on purchases. Membership is free and available to anyone aged 18 and older. Members earn points on every purchase—typically one point per dollar spent—which convert to rewards at various thresholds. A hundred points generally translates to roughly $5-10 in rewards, depending on membership tier. For seniors making regular athletic purchases, this can provide meaningful savings over time.
The Creators Club operates on a tiered system with three levels: Creators Club (free entry), Gold (requires minimum annual spending), and Platinum (requires higher spending thresholds). While many seniors won't advance beyond the free level, even basic membership provides advantages. Members receive early access to sales, exclusive product releases, and personalized recommendations based on purchase history. The program also allows members to set up birthday notifications, which often trigger special discount codes sent to registered email addresses.
Major retailers carrying Adidas products maintain separate loyalty programs that sometimes complement Adidas purchases. Dick's Sporting Goods ScoreCard provides points on all purchases, including Adidas items. The program is free to join and offers 5% back on qualified purchases. For seniors shopping at Dick's regularly, this can accumulate to $50-100 in annual rewards. Kohl's Cash operates similarly, giving customers store rewards that can offset future purchases—sometimes resulting in effective discounts of 15-20% when strategically applied.
Credit card partnerships represent another avenue for accumulating rewards on Adidas purchases. American Express, Visa, and Mastercard offer partnerships with sporting goods retailers that provide bonus points or cash back on purchases. Some cards specifically target older adults with benefits like extended warranties and purchase protection.
